In the world of construction and building materials, one term that frequently arises is the moisture proof barrier. This term refers to a material or system designed to prevent moisture from penetrating through walls, floors, and ceilings. The importance of a moisture proof barrier cannot be overstated, as it plays a critical role in maintaining the integrity of structures and ensuring the health of their inhabitants. Without proper moisture control, buildings can suffer from a range of issues, including mold growth, structural damage, and decreased indoor air quality.One of the primary functions of a moisture proof barrier is to protect against water vapor diffusion. Water vapor is present in the air, and when it comes into contact with cooler surfaces, it can condense and lead to moisture accumulation. This is particularly problematic in areas such as basements and crawl spaces, where humidity levels tend to be higher. By installing a moisture proof barrier, builders can effectively reduce the amount of moisture that enters these spaces, thereby preventing potential damage.There are various materials available that can serve as effective moisture proof barriers. Common options include polyethylene sheets, rubber membranes, and specialized paints or coatings. Each material has its own advantages and disadvantages, depending on the specific requirements of the project. For instance, polyethylene sheets are often used in residential construction due to their affordability and ease of installation. On the other hand, rubber membranes may be preferred for commercial applications where enhanced durability is necessary.In addition to preventing moisture intrusion, a moisture proof barrier can also contribute to energy efficiency in buildings. When moisture enters a structure, it can lead to increased heating and cooling costs, as the HVAC system must work harder to maintain comfortable indoor conditions. By keeping moisture at bay, a moisture proof barrier helps to regulate temperature and reduce energy consumption, ultimately leading to cost savings for homeowners and businesses alike.Moreover, the presence of a moisture proof barrier can enhance overall indoor air quality. Excess moisture can create an environment conducive to mold growth, which can have serious health implications for occupants. By implementing a moisture proof barrier, builders can significantly reduce the likelihood of mold proliferation, thereby creating a healthier living or working environment.It is important to note that while a moisture proof barrier is essential, it should be part of a comprehensive moisture management strategy. This includes proper drainage systems, ventilation, and regular maintenance checks. Neglecting any aspect of moisture control can undermine the effectiveness of the barrier itself.In conclusion, the significance of a moisture proof barrier in construction cannot be overlooked. It serves as a vital line of defense against moisture-related issues that can compromise the safety, durability, and comfort of a building. Homeowners and builders alike should prioritize the installation of appropriate moisture proof barriers to ensure long-lasting, healthy, and efficient structures.
